Characteristics of drilling fluid chemicals for shale inhibition and stability
Shale formations encountered all through drilling are inclined to respond unpredictably, leading to expensive delays and products have on Otherwise effectively managed. Drilling fluid corporations ever more count on polymers that work as shale inhibitors by forming a protective movie on shale surfaces, which restrictions hydration and dispersal of cuttings. These polymers will have to have precise chemical and Actual physical properties to function proficiently beneath high-temperature circumstances normally exceeding one hundred eighty°C. as an example, a polymer with high intrinsic viscosity and a significant potassium ion content material can stabilize clay minerals in the development, cutting down swelling and sloughing. On top of that, the purity in the product plays a vital function in its reactivity and compatibility with several fluid techniques. By integrating this sort of polymers, drilling fluids obtain improved rheology qualities that support Regulate filtration loss and greatly enhance viscosity, that are very important for sustaining wellbore integrity. Drilling chemicals suppliers that present materials Assembly these criteria allow drilling fluid organizations to tailor formulations for equally freshwater and saturated saltwater environments, addressing sophisticated geological challenges when maintaining operational performance.
great things about small-solids drilling polymer in directional and mining functions
Directional drilling and mining functions desire drilling fluid additives that deliver regular lubrication and wellbore security though minimizing solids information to circumvent abnormal wear and torque on drill strings. Low-solids polymers from respected drilling chemical compounds suppliers provide this purpose by forming a skinny, lubricating movie on borehole walls and drilling products. This coating don't just safeguards shale surfaces but in addition cuts down mechanical friction, facilitating smoother directional modifications and deeper penetration with lessened risk of trapped pipe incidents. For mining applications and tunneling, the reduction of solids within the fluid composition lowers the event of filter cake buildup, which may compromise formation permeability and h2o circulation. Drilling fluid companies enjoy how these polymers assist for a longer period intervals concerning bit replacements and decrease downtime linked to routine maintenance. What's more, the compatibility of lower-solids polymers with various base fluids—freshwater and saltwater—improves their versatility throughout diverse terrains and operational setups. This adaptability aids fluid engineers in optimizing drilling parameters to extend tools lifestyle cycles and trim overall challenge prices.
Dosage optimization of polymers in freshwater and saltwater drilling fluids
Achieving the proper polymer dosage is essential to maximizing the advantages of specialised drilling chemical compounds supplied by top drilling substances suppliers. Freshwater and saltwater drilling fluids react otherwise to polymer additions due to variable ionic compositions, necessitating precise changes in concentration to balance performance and value. by way of example, a dosage selection close to 0.1% to 0.5% is typically successful for freshwater formulations, where by polymers assist in lowering filtration reduction and improving viscosity without creating too much gel energy. Saltwater slurries, nevertheless, normally demand increased concentrations—involving 0.eight% and one.2%—to counteract the much better ionic interactions that can destabilize shale and weaken film formation. Drilling fluid businesses closely monitor these parameters, calibrating polymer concentrations to match the particular geological surroundings and drilling method. In tough eventualities involving elaborate rock varieties or high temperature and pressure, wonderful-tuning polymer dosage can appreciably affect The soundness on the borehole plus the preservation of drill string integrity.
